What is Wildwood?

Wildwoood is a multiplayer text-based roleplaying game set in an isolated beach town surrounded by a dark and mysterious forest full of wild and wicked dreams. Each player plays a character just arriving, joining the community in the fight against the Nightmare of Nothingness, threatning to devour everything.

Anyone can enter Wildwood. No one can leave.

Within the forest, your dreams become a warped reality, twisted by the Nightmare. Foray with your companions to face their fears and your own. Unshroud the mysteries of your mind.

The only way to survive Wildwood is to tell your story.


Gameplay Overview

Roleplay: Text-based RP with simple TTRPG-like game mechanics to help with storytelling.

Setting: There are two main settings: the town and the forest of dreams. Within the town, you may engage socially, have a job, interact with game-wide plots. Within the forest of dreams, you join or lead forays to stave off the Nightmare of Nothingness from consuming the town. Players are the storytellers within these forest forays and have flexibilty in how to design them.

Storytellers: Everyone can be a storyteller in Wildwood by building your own mini-plots in the forest of dreams using a simple toolset. These plots can potentially link with overarching game plots led by staff storytellers.

System: Within forest forays, TTRPG-like game mechanics are used. These mechanics are heavily inspired by Monster of the Week, a Powered by the Apocolpyse TTRPG.

Alts: You may have only one main character at any given time but are able to assume multiple personas & 'classes' within the forest of dreams.

Growth: Your character earns XP through joining forays into the forest. There's a small daily cap, so grinding is not possible.

Building: Every character can create 'dream' rooms and 'dream' NPCs, and also 'real' items, clothing, and food. There are daily and XP based limits to the amount you can create.

Grid: All roleplay happens on a grid like in a MUD. There's a world to explore and create. There are no scenes like in a MUSH, but in many ways, forest forays are isolated from the rest of the world and function much like a MUSH scene.

Death and Retirement are optional: Your character can be injured, but they won't die unless you request this from staff. Likewise, you can keep your character for as long as the game is running.
